@font-face {
  font-family: 'EmojiFont';
  src: url('https://gutz.neocities.org/grfx/EmojiFont.eot'); /* IE9 Compat Modes */
  src: url('https://gutz.neocities.org/grfx/EmojiFont.eot?#iefix') format('embedded-opentype'), /* IE6-IE8 */
       url('https://gutz.neocities.org/grfx/EmojiFont.woff2') format('woff2'), /* Super Modern Browsers */
       url('https://gutz.neocities.org/grfx/EmojiFont.woff') format('woff'), /* Pretty Modern Browsers */
       url('https://gutz.neocities.org/grfx/EmojiFont.TTF')  format('truetype'), /* Safari, Android, iOS */
       url('https://gutz.neocities.org/grfx/EmojiFont.svg#svgspirit') format('svg'); /* Legacy iOS */
}

@font-face {
  font-family: 'Spirit';
  src: url('https://gutz.neocities.org/grfx/Spirit.eot'); /* IE9 Compat Modes */
  src: url('https://gutz.neocities.org/grfx/Spirit.eot?#iefix') format('embedded-opentype'), /* IE6-IE8 */
       url('https://gutz.neocities.org/grfx/Spirit.woff2') format('woff2'), /* Super Modern Browsers */
       url('https://gutz.neocities.org/grfx/Spirit.woff') format('woff'), /* Pretty Modern Browsers */
       url('https://gutz.neocities.org/grfx/Spirit.TTF')  format('truetype'), /* Safari, Android, iOS */
       url('https://gutz.neocities.org/grfx/Spirit.svg#svgspirit') format('svg'); /* Legacy iOS */
}
 
body{
 background-color: white;
 font-size: 10.5pt;
 font-family: MS Gothic, verdana;
 color: #7f3f40;
 background-color: #ffffff;
 cursor:url('/image/cursor.gif'), auto;
 text-align:justify!important;}

::-webkit-scrollbar {
  width: 10px;
  height: 10px;
background: white;
}
::-webkit-scrollbar-button {
  width: 0px;
  height: 0px;
}
::-webkit-scrollbar-thumb {
  background: #ffeef2;
  border: 0px none #ffeef2;
  border-radius: 0px;
  -webkit-border-radius: 5px;
-moz-border-radius: 5px;
border-radius: 5px;
padding: 20px 3px 3px 3px;
border: 1px dotted #7f3f40;
}
::-webkit-scrollbar-thumb:hover {
  background: #ffeef2;
}
::-webkit-scrollbar-thumb:active {
  background: #ffeef2;
}
::-webkit-scrollbar-track {
  background: white;
  border: 0px none transparent;
  border-radius: 0px;
}
::-webkit-scrollbar-track:hover {
background: white;
}
::-webkit-scrollbar-track:active {
background: white;
}
::-webkit-scrollbar-corner {
background: white;}


a, a:link, a:visited, a:active {
 color: #feacc1 !important;
 text-decoration: none !important;
cursor:url('image/cursor.gif'), auto;
font-weight: normal;}


i, b, u, strong, em, .strong, .em {
 color: #eeaebc;
 text-decoration: none !important;
cursor:url('image/cursor.gif'), auto;}

a:hover {color:#7f3f40;
background:;
cursor:url('image/cursorhover.gif'), auto;}

#womb
{width:1500px;
margin-left: 120px;}

#container
{width:1500px;
background-color:transparent;
margin-left: 0px;
height:100%;
min-height:100%;
position:absolute;
text-align: justify;}

#rosel {
width:100px;
height:102%;
background: url(image/sideflip.gif);
background-color:transparent;
background-position: right;
background-repeat: repeat-y;
margin-left:100px;
position:fixed;
top:-10px;}

#rose {
width: 120px;
padding-right: 40px;
height:102%;
background: url(image/side.gif);
background-color:transparent;
background-position: left;
background-repeat: repeat-y;
margin-left:1050px;
position:fixed;
top:-10px;}

#nav {
width:200px;
height: ;
background: url();
position: fixed;
background-color:transparent;
left:40px;
bottom: 40px;}

#lace {
width:0px;
height:102%;
background: url(image/r.gif);
background-color:transparent;
background-position: left;
background-repeat: repeat-y;
margin-left:0px;
position:fixed;
top:-10px;
display:none;}

#content {
margin-left:0px;
text-align:justify!important;
width:1200px;
color:#7f3f40;
background-color:white;
padding-top:5px;
padding-left:10px;
padding-right:10px;
padding-bottom:10px;
min-height:110% !important;
margin-top:-10px;
}

h1:first-letter {}

h1 {
font-family: Spirit, MS Gothic; 
font-style:regular; 
font-size:12pt;
color: #ffbfcf!important;
text-transform: lowercase;
font-weight: normal;
text-align: center;
}

h2 {
font-family: Spirit, MS Gothic; 
background: url('image/menu3.gif')!important;
font-style:regular; 
font-size:12pt;
letter-spacing:;
background-position: center;
background-repeat: no-repeat;
font-case: lowercase;
text-transform: lowercase;
font-weight: normal;
text-align: center;
min-height:10px;
padding-top:11px;
padding-bottom:12px;
width:817px;
height: 16px;
@font-face {font-family: "spirit";
src: url('https://www.dropbox.com/s/a63carms581dqub/LITTLESPIRIT.TTF?dl=1')
}

h3 {
font-family: Spirit, MS Gothic; 
color: #ffbfcf;
font-size:12pt;
text-transform: lowercase; 
font-weight: normal;
text-align: center;
@font-face {font-family: "spirit";
src: url('https://www.dropbox.com/s/a63carms581dqub/LITTLESPIRIT.TTF?dl=1')
}


input, textarea, .input, .textarea {
background-color:white; font-family: MS Gothic; font-size:10px; width: 88px; height: 31px; border: none; 
-webkit-border-radius: 10px;
-moz-border-radius: 10px;
border-radius: 10px;
border: 1px dotted #7f3f40;
background: url('https://gutz.neocities.org/image/dotts.gif')!important;
}

li::before {
content: "";
color:white;
background: url(image/bullet.gif);
background-repeat: no-repeat;
padding-left:20px;}

li {
list-style-type: none;
padding-left:5px;
line-height:14px;}

ul  {
list-style-type: none;
    margin: 0;
    padding: 0;}
    
#s-m-t-tooltip { 
z-index:9999999999999; 
max-width: 500px;
word-wrap:break-word; 
display: block; 
font: inherit; 
 color: #7f3f40;
line-height: 12px; 
padding: 6px 9px 6px 10px;
margin: 10px 10px 10px 15px; 
border: 1px dotted #7f3f40;; 
-webkit-border-radius: 5px;
-moz-border-radius: 5px; 
border-radius: 5px;
padding:5px;  
background-color: white;
text-align:justify;
background: url('https://gutz.neocities.org/image/dotts.gif')!important;}